Politicians throw eggs at Kosovo prime minister on live television
September 23, 2015  02:26
Politicians pelted Kosovo's prime minister Isa Mustafa with eggs live on television as he addressed the parliament, protesting a deal with former master Serbia which gives greater local powers to minority Serbs in the young Balkan country.

During a speech by the prime minister broadcast live on Kosovo television, several opposition politicians suddenly stood and began throwing eggs at him.

Mustafa's bodyguard rushed to shield him with an umbrella.

The opposition in majority-Albanian Kosovo, which declared independence from Serbia in 2008, is angry over a deal brokered by the European Union last month giving Kosovo's small Serb minority more rights over municipal spending and education, and access to funding from Belgrade.

Parliament speaker Kadri Veseli halted the session, shouting "shame, shame, shame!" at the egg-throwing MPs.
